#14782f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14782f is composed of 7.8% red, 47.1%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.8%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 136.2 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 27.5%. #14782f color hex could be obtained by blending #28f05e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#14782f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#14782f has RGB values of R:20, G:120,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 1341487.

Shades and Tints of #14782f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#f0fdf4 is the lightest one.
